#1: Keep it in the Corner with Corner Racks
We all know how those awkward cabinet or counter spaces go unused because it’s hard to get kitchen tools or food items to fit. Make them more accessible and expand storage by adding one or two more shelves with corner racks.
Corner racks can be used inside of a cabinet to create shelves for different plate sizes – find your china easily before dinner is served. Depending on the size of the rack, these racks are also helpful for keeping a variety of canned goods separated for easy access.
#2: Put a Seal on it with Storage Containers
Are your dry foods like beans, rice, pasta and nuts still in the manufacturer’s bag, hidden behind other food supplies? Tired of rummaging through cabinets looking for that last ingredient that would make your pot sizzle? Bring food front and center in sleek, glass containers with airtight seals that preserve freshness.
Add Je ne sais quoi to your kitchen décor, while organizing the space!
Since most storage containers are made of glass, you can spruce up your kitchen décor by placing the containers on your counter. The biggest benefit of these containers is that they come in a variety of styles to give a modern look to your kitchen if you have the space.
#3: Keep Sugar & Spice & Everything that’s Nice Right at Your Fingertips
Spice Racks
With the variety of modern and traditional designs that are available, there’s no reason not to add functionality to your kitchen with a spice rack. Stainless steel cylinders fit into an ultra-modern kitchen, and hardwood racks complement a classic kitchen design.
Spice racks are especially useful for people who have limited counter or cabinet space. Find them in your favorite food-storage store.
#4: Now Center It!
Moveable Islands
Moveable islands or carts are a great way to add cabinet space in a jiffy. The extra space to chop and mix isn’t the only benefit that you can enjoy from this addition. Storage space can be found in the form of open shelves or a closed cabinet area that works in the same way that the other cabinets in your kitchen work.
But don’t forget to protect your floors! You could ruin perfectly finished tile or hardwood floors with scuff marks. When choosing your island, find one with locking rubber casters that will guard your floor when moving.
#5: Lastly: Turn to a Lazy-Susan & Put Everything in its Place
These turntables swivel to 360-degree angles making hard-to-reach items more accessible. Use these to help organize cabinet shelves or get a portable one to display napkins on the table. Organizing your kitchen is a matter of utilizing tools like these that make finding things easier.
